The Parish Council is made up of 15 Councillors and a Clerk. The Council meet every month for a full Council Meeting and twice a month for Planning Meetings.
Notification of meetings plus agenda can always be found on the parish notice boards, at least three days prior to a meeting and on this web site. Any parishioner may have items considered at meetings, this is best done through the Clerk, in writing, or for more urgent issues the Chair and Vice-Chair are happy to be contacted. Although members of the Public are not permitted to speak during the meetings, time is always made available prior to the start of a meeting.
